Kings Park Refurbishment of Existing Office Building & External Additions
Awards
2013 Australian Institute of Building Western Australia Professional Excellence in Building Award – Commercial Construction $1million to $10million
The project consisted of the refurbishment of an existing three storey office block into art gallery floor space with the third and ground level also comprising of toilets and kitchens. A glass atrium lobby was also constructed which connected the building with the building next door to form an extravagant entry statement to the new gallery space.
The roof of the third level was also raised by 1500mm to increase the ceiling height. The mechanical system created many challenges due to working with existing structure and space restrictions and formed an integral part to the project, as temperatures in the space are critical due to being a gallery. A high level of finishes completed the boardroom, lobby and toilets to create a luxurious experience whilst using the common space outside the galleries.
With the project being situated on Kings Park road access, programming and sequence of works were vital to the success and timely completion of the project.
